Overview

Postcode SK12 2AN is located in an urban city, within the Disley ward of Cheshire East in the North West region, and forms part of the Disley & Lyme Park area. It has moderate de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 17.8 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. The average income per household in Disley & Lyme Park is £55,147 per year. The nearest station is Disley located about 1.3 miles away. There are no primary and no secondary schools in the area.

Property prices in Disley

Based on 78 recent sales, the median property price is £348,000 in Disley area, with individual transactions ranging from £110,000 up to £1,100,000.
